What Stump Grinding Is and How It Works

Stump grinding is the most efficient, cost-effective method to remove a stump below ground level. Instead of excavating the entire root system, professionals use a high-powered grinder to chip away at the stump until it’s reduced to wood chips and a shallow root collar remains. This approach minimizes soil disturbance and gets your yard ready for reuse quickly.

The stump grinding process—step by step

  1. Site inspection: We assess stump size, proximity to structures, and underground utilities.
  2. Safety setup: Protective barriers and safety gear are put in place before work begins.
  3. Grinding: The stump is ground down to a recommended depth—typically 4–12 inches below grade—depending on your future plans for the area.
  4. Cleanup: Wood chips are collected or spread as requested, and the area is raked smooth.
  5. Final inspection: We confirm the job meets safety and aesthetic expectations.

Aftercare and Landscaping Tips Post-Grinding

Once a stump is ground, you’ll have options for the space:

  • Fill the hole with topsoil and plant grass or flowers.
  • Use remaining wood chips as mulch in other parts of your yard—just avoid piling mulch against tree trunks.
  • Compact and level the area if you plan to install hardscape or turf.
  • Monitor for new sprouts from the root system; we can treat or remove regrowth if needed.

With the right aftercare, your yard will look cleaner, safer, and ready for new projects.

What is stump grinding and how is it different from full stump removal?

Stump grinding uses a rotating cutting wheel to reduce a tree stump to wood chips and grind it below ground level, leaving a clean, usable surface. Full stump removal digs the entire root system out, which is more invasive and often more expensive. How long does stump grinding take, and will it damage my yard?

Time depends on stump diameter, root structure, and site access—small stumps can take 15–30 minutes, while large or difficult stumps may take a few hours.
